Transaction 30ba83c8cb9c1100c9270ba8304646fde319b3259d6cd9baf90c38d7e5a6018a
1 Input
1 Output
-
30ba83c8cb9c1100c9270ba8304646fde319b3259d6cd9baf90c38d7e5a6018a:0
- value
- 3828474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b3a0fafa2b8a83b68e56353c4fd91b3ca7ff196 OP_EQUAL
- address
- 376BM2gQSXf8zy6E8AMwmejfz7xubeTV69